Emergency Building Repairs: Everything You Need to Know

When unanticipated catastrophes strike structures, whether residential or commercial, the requirement for emergency repairs ends up being critical. Emergencies can develop from different causes such as natural disasters, accidents, or abrupt system failures. Understanding the Need for Emergency Repairs

Emergency building repairs are essential to preserve security, avoid further damage, and bring back functionality. Postponing repairs can lead to increased expenses and risks. Understanding the typical causes of emergency situations can help homeowner act quickly and successfully.

Typical Causes of Emergency Building Repairs

TriggerDescription
Natural DisastersEvents such as storms, earthquakes, or flooding that can badly damage structures.
FireDamage from flames or smoke can compromise the integrity of a building.
Accidental DamageConcerns emerging from automobile crashes, explosions, or other unpredicted accidents.
System FailuresUnexpected breakdown of pipes, electrical, or HVAC systems that require instant attention.
Pest InfestationSignificant existence of pests can cause structural damage and health hazards.

Recognizing Emergency Situations

Acknowledging what makes up an emergency is essential for reliable action. Not all repairs are urgent, but some scenarios require immediate intervention to secure occupants and property.

Signs of an Emergency

  1. Structural Damage: Cracks in walls, ceilings, or structures that appear suddenly.

  2. Water Leaks: Sudden leakages from pipes or roofing systems that may cause flooding or water damage.

  3. Gas Odors: A strong smell of gas showing a possible leak.

  4. Electrical Issues: Flickering lights, triggers from outlets, or any signs of electrical failure.

  5. Fire Damage: Visible burns, smoke, or charring on walls or ceilings.

Immediate Actions to Take

In the occasion of an emergency, understanding how to react can reduce damage and improve security. Here are steps to follow when faced with an emergency building scenario:

Step-by-Step Emergency Response

  1. Assess Safety: Ensure the security of all occupants. Leave if necessary.

  2. Contact Emergency Services: For fires, gas leaks, or extreme structural damage, dial emergency services right away.

  3. Shut Off Utilities: If safe to do so, switch off electricity, gas, and supply of water to prevent more damage.

  4. Document the Damage: Take pictures and notes to offer to your insurance company.

  5. Avoid Further Damage: Use tarps, buckets, or other makeshift steps to include leakages or cover openings.

  6. Call Professionals: Contact a licensed professional or repair service concentrating on emergency repairs.

Choosing the Right Repair Professionals

Selecting the right professionals for emergency building repairs is critical. A knowledgeable contractor can assist ensure that repairs are finished securely and efficiently.

Tips for Hiring Emergency Repair Services

  1. Inspect Credentials: Ensure that contractors are licensed and guaranteed.

  2. Get Referrals: Ask good friends, household, or associates for suggestions.

  3. Check out Reviews: Look for evaluations online to evaluate a contractor's credibility.

  4. Demand Estimates: Obtain a minimum of three composed price quotes detailing the scope of work and costs.

  5. Ask about Experience: Ask the length of time the professional has actually been in business and their experience with comparable repairs.

  6. Verify Warranty: Ensure that the work comes with a guarantee for products and labor.

Frequently Asked Questions About Emergency Building Repairs

What should I do if I experience a leak during a storm?

If you discover a leak throughout a storm, move valuables to a safe area and usage pails to catch water. Contact a repair service as quickly as conditions enable.

How can I get ready for emergency situations?

Regular building maintenance, evaluation of systems (HVAC, pipes, electrical), and having an emergency strategy in location can assist minimize risks.

Are emergency repairs covered by insurance?

Many house owner's or commercial insurance coverage cover emergency repairs, however it's vital to review your policy for specifics concerning protection and deductibles.

Can I try repairs myself?

While minor problems may be manageable, it's a good idea to work with professionals for significant repairs to guarantee safety and compliance with building regulations.

Just how much do emergency repairs cost?

Costs depend on the kind of emergency, products needed, labor, and the level of damage. It's vital to get multiple estimates for accurate budgeting.
